How is float represented in Java?

Java uses a subset of the IEEE 754 binary floating point standard to represent floating point numbers and define the results of arithmetic operations. … A float is represented using 32 bits, and each possible combination of bits represents one real number.

What is difference between float and double in java?

Double takes more space but more precise during computation and float takes less space but less precise. According to the IEEE standards, float is a 32 bit representation of a real number while double is a 64 bit representation. In Java programs we normally mostly see the use of double data type.

How do you assign a float variable in Java?

You can’t assign a double value to a float without an explicit narrowing conversion. You therefore have two options: For literals, use the suffix f or F to denote a float value. For non-literals, use an explicit cast (float)

What is byte type?

byte: The byte data type is an 8-bit signed two’s complement integer. It has a minimum value of -128 and a maximum value of 127 (inclusive). The byte data type can be useful for saving memory in large arrays, where the memory savings actually matters.

What does it mean when float object is not callable?

The “TypeError: ‘float’ object is not callable” error happens if you follow a floating point value with parenthesis. This can happen if: You have named a variable “float” and try to use the float() function later in your code. You forget an operand in a mathematical problem.

What is Python float?

The float type in Python represents the floating point number. Float is used to represent real numbers and is written with a decimal point dividing the integer and fractional parts. For example, 97.98, 32.3+e18, -32.54e100 all are floating point numbers.

What is the difference between float and double?

What’s the difference ? double has 2x more precision then float. float is a 32 bit IEEE 754 single precision Floating Point Number1 bit for the sign, (8 bits for the exponent, and 23* for the value), i.e. float has 7 decimal digits of precision.

Is 99.9 float or double?

Floating-point numbers are by default of type double. Therefore 99.9 is a double, not a float. What is a double data type example? Double can store numbers between the range -1.7 x 10308 to +1.7 x 10308.

Is float faster than double?

Floats are faster than doubles when you don’t need double’s precision and you are memory-bandwidth bound and your hardware doesn’t carry a penalty on floats. They conserve memory-bandwidth because they occupy half the space per number.

How is a float stored?

Floating-point numbers are encoded by storing the significand and the exponent (along with a sign bit). Like signed integer types, the high-order bit indicates sign; 0 indicates a positive value, 1 indicates negative. The next 8 bits are used for the exponent.

What is int object not callable?

The “TypeError: ‘int’ object is not callable” error is raised when you try to call an integer. This can happen if you forget to include a mathematical operator in a calculation. This error can also occur if you accidentally override a built-in function that you use later in your code, like round() or sum() .
